How to Order Heavy Duty Connectors A Step-by-Step Guide

HA 10 pins heavy duty male female connectors

Ordering the right heavy duty connectors ensures reliability in industrial automation, energy, and machinery. Follow this 7-step process to specify your requirements accurately and streamline procurement.

1. Determine Electrical Ratings

Start by defining your voltage and current needs:

Voltage: 250V to 1,000V.

Current: 10A to 200A continuous load capacity.

2. Select Insert Configuration

HK-004-8-M combination heavy duty connector insert

Choose pins, plating, and termination:

Pin Count: 3 to 216 contacts (signal/power hybrid options available).

Plating:

Gold: For corrosion resistance (medical, marine).

Silver: Cost-effective for high-current industrial use.

Termination types of heavy duty connectors:

Screw Terminal: Tool-free installation.

Crimp Terminal: Vibration-proof (IEC 61373 compliant).

Cage Clamp: Quick-wire for 0.14–2.5mm² cables.

3. Housing & Hood Configuration

Match hoods and housings to inserts and environmental needs:

Hoods:

Low/High construction for space constraints.

Top/Side cable entry (IP68 glands included).

1 or 2 locking levers (vibration resistance).

Housings:

Bulkhead/Surface mounting or cable-to-cable.

Optional protection covers for unused ports.

IP Rating: IP65 (dust/water jets) or IP68 (submersion).

Thread Compatibility: M12–M40, PG7–PG21, or NPT.

Example: Han E 006 inserts require 6B hoods/housings.

4. Accessories

Enhance functionality with:

Cable Glands: Metal (EMI shielding) or plastic (lightweight).

Hose Kits: For pneumatic-hybrid connectors.
